Title: David J Havell: Innovator in Adaptive Driver Training

Introduction

David J Havell is a prominent inventor based in Salt Lake City, UT (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of adaptive driver training, holding a total of 15 patents. His innovative work focuses on enhancing the training experience for drivers and operators through advanced technology.

Latest Patents

One of Havell's latest patents is a system, method, and apparatus for adaptive driver training. This invention includes a training system that collects data from at least one input device during a simulation segment. The data is analyzed to predict potential future issues, and if a potential issue is identified, an informational message is presented to warn the trainee. Another notable patent is an application for an adaptive training system that features a computer interfaced with one or more graphics displays and input/output devices. This system allows trainees to interact with the adaptive training system as if they were operating a target vehicle, providing valuable feedback and training based on their performance.
